Parents are prioritising key features in navigation tools for Back-to-School commutes

New survey sheds light on how parents are managing the back-to-school season and the their essential features for streamlining their travel

As the new school year commences, Yango Maps, the advanced navigation app, has conducted a comprehensive survey among Dubai’s parents to understand their specific needs and preferences for daily commutes.

The findings reveal that 72% of parents find preparing for the school year a time-consuming process, with 67% initiating preparations one to three months in advance. For 73% of respondents, the school is located in a different neighbourhood, necessitating daily commutes for drop-offs and pickups. Most children are transported either by school bus (63%) or by car (40%).

Additionally, children’s after-school activities add to the travel burden, with 67% of parents driving their children to these activities two to four times a week. On average, 60% of parents spend between 20 and 60 minutes travelling to school or after-school activities. Consequently, 72% report an increase in driving time during the school season, highlighting the need for efficient navigation solutions.

The survey highlights several challenges faced by parents, including road traffic (62%) and the difficulty of finding parking (59%). Nearly half of the respondents (49%) seek to reduce travel time, with 42% valuing accurate arrival time predictions.

Key features that parents prioritise in a navigation app include:

  • Arrival Time Accuracy and Traffic Updates: Over half of the respondents (54%) prioritise precise arrival time predictions, while 49% value real-time traffic updates. These features are crucial for managing timely school drop-offs and pickups, especially during peak traffic periods.
